General Relativity coupled with Non-Linear Electrodynamics: results and limitations

Abstract
We discuss how to generate a black hole solution of the Einstein Equations (EE) via non-linear electrodynamics (NED). We discuss the thermodynamical properties of a general NED solution, recovering the First Law. Then we illustrate the general mechanism and discuss some specific cases, showing that finding a generating Lagrangian (for a specific solution) only requires solving an algebraic equation (we study some analytical cases). Finally, we argue that NED paradigm, though self-consistent, is not the best tool for studying regular black holes.
